## Deployment

Torchvale partitions its events table by calendar month. At deploy time, the migration job pre-creates partitions for the current month plus two ahead; if that job fails, inserts for a new month will error at midnight on the first. On-call engineers should confirm partition creation succeeded before signing off on any deploy that lands near month boundaries. The partition manager reads its schedule and retention behavior from the configuration shown here.

deployment values, yadug-bawif:
[framir]
team = pelox
access_code = ac_a38ab2
owner = tamion.julael
host = framir.tolvaqlabs.test
port = 11211
peer = tammir.zemvargrid.local
salt = 2215ef03
pin = 1541

# ReminderJob — Environments

Cadence Clinic's appointment reminder job runs in three environments: dev, staging, prod. Dev uses a stubbed SMS gateway; staging sends to an internal test number pool only. Prod runs every 15 minutes against the live booking table. Schedules differ per environment — never copy prod settings into staging. Retry limits and quiet-hours windows are enforced by config, not code. If reminders stop, check the queue depth before touching anything. Current prod configuration follows.

settings of fafog-haduf:
ZORIX_PIN=4648
ZORIX_METRICS_HOST=metrics.zorix.paliqsys.corp
ZORIX_LOG_LEVEL=info
ZORIX_TENANT=druix

Handover note — for the Tarnwick site office

Since Tarnwick still has no working printer, this month's payslips were printed at head office and sealed individually, then packed together in one plain envelope. Please check the count against the staff list on arrival and store them in the locked drawer until distribution. The courier bringing them must follow the confidential instruction noted directly below.

dispatch memo: the aldath julath courier leaves the zoriel queneth oliok ledger at gate 3795 under passcode 816528